Software cohesion and coupling
WebFeb 19, 2024 · High Cohesion and low coupling give us better designed code that is easier to maintain. High cohesion: Elements within one class/module should functionally belong together and do one particular thing. Loose coupling: Among different classes/modules should be minimal dependency.
